METTLER v. METTLER

No. 37844.

140 A.3d 370 (2016)

165 Conn.App. 829

Elizabeth METTLER v. Kirsten METTLER.

Appellate Court of Connecticut.

Decided May 31, 2016.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

David N. Rubin , filed a brief for the appellant (plaintiff).

Susan E. Nugent , New Haven, filed a brief for the appellee (defendant).

LAVINE, BEACH and MULLINS, Js.


The plaintiff, Elizabeth Mettler, appeals from the judgment of the trial court finding her in contempt for wilfully failing to pay the defendant, Kirsten Mettler, one half of certain of their child's extracurricular activity expenses, pursuant to a postdissolution agreement that the parties had entered into and that was approved by the...
